I tried syncing from scratch with an old laptop with hdd, was really surprised when it only took 32 minutes from start to synced and running.
Same old laptop with krlnx qt-wallet took 29 minutes to sync from scratch, cpu usage is down A LOT, it is not cpu limited anymore. Also started testing with palgin compiled 1.3 windows wallets, we'll see where they go. Last two weeks without problems with wallets. Did you try cryptonited with tcmalloc allocator? It will be more fast.

Did you try cryptonited with tcmalloc allocator? It will be more fast.
Compiled from krlnx/Cryptonite with tcmalloc allocator, 26 minutes from scratch. Biggest difference vs. qt is even lower cpu usage, now max usage on that weak laptop is 7% when adding block. For comparison I tried windows + cryptonited 1.3 + ssd + desktop i5 and syncing was actually slower, 33 minutes!?
